[0018] Various embodiments of the present invention provide systems and methods for providing a basic power supply to a server system when a standby power supply of a power supply unit (PSU) of the server system fails. The system includes multiple active components, one or more PSUs, and a power switch. The power switch is connected to the standby power output terminal and the main power output terminal of the one or more PSUs. The power switch can receive status information of the one or more PSUs and can determine whether the main power of these PSUs is within a predetermined range. In the event that the standby power of the PSUs fails and the main power of the PSUs is within the predetermined range, the power switch may switch an input power from the standby power of the PSUs to the main power and output a Base power supply for system use.

Description

technical field [0001] The present invention relates to power supply unit management for computing systems. Background technique [0002] Today's server farms or data centers usually employ a large number of servers to handle computing demands to satisfy various application services. Each server handles multiple operations and requires some degree of power consumption to maintain these operations. Some of these operations are "mission critical" operations, and disruption of these "mission critical" operations may result in a significant security breach or loss of revenue for users associated with these operations. [0003] One source of the foregoing interruption is a failure or error of a power supply unit (PSU) of the server system. For example, a failure or error in the standby power supply of the PSU will cause the server system to shut down suddenly, which may result in data loss of the server system, or even damage the server system.
